Evaluation of the Digestive and Metabolic Utilisation of Dietary Protein in Patients With Chronic Pancreatitis
Phase 4
Completed
- Conditions
- Chronic Pancreatitis
- Registration Number
- NCT00957151
- Lead Sponsor
- Hospital Avicenne
- Brief Summary
The objective is to evaluate the dietary nitrogen assimilation and metabolic utilisation capability of patients with chronic pancreatitis.

Inclusion Criteria
- subjects with chronic pancreatitis and taking enzyme replacement therapy
Exclusion Criteria
- patients with hepatic impairment
- patients allergic to dairy proteins
- urinary incontinence affecting the measurement of nitrogen metabolism
- digestive disorder affecting the absorption of nutrients
